HumanEvalFunction synthesis — 164 small Python problems: the AI is given a function's description and has to write the working function. This was the coding benchmark of the GPT-3.5 and GPT-4 era, before the field moved to fixing real bugs in real repositories. Higher is better. | 71.2% | — |
Terminal-Bench 2.0Agentic terminal coding — Can the AI work in a command-line terminal — running commands and finishing technical setup tasks the way a developer would? (Version 2.0 of the test.) Higher is better. | — | 36.2% |
MMLUGeneral knowledge — A 57-subject multiple-choice exam — history, law, medicine, maths — that was the standard measure of how much a model knows from 2020 until roughly 2024, when frontier scores crowded into the high 80s and labs moved on to harder tests. The scores here were published years apart under different testing setups, so read them as a historical record rather than a like-for-like ranking. Higher is better. | 78.5% | — |
GSM8KGrade-school math — Grade-school maths word problems that take a few steps of arithmetic to work through. It separated the models of 2022 and 2023 sharply, then saturated. One caveat on the historical numbers: OpenAI included part of the GSM8K training set in GPT-4's pre-training mix, so GPT-4's score is not a clean few-shot result. Higher is better. | 88% | — |

Frequently asked questions
Claude 2 and Qwen3-Coder-Next don't publish scores on any of the same benchmarks, so there's no direct head-to-head comparison. Only Qwen3-Coder-Next has a verified first-party API price: $0.30 per million input tokens and $1.50 per million output tokens. No pay-as-you-go API rate is tracked for Claude 2. Claude 2 shipped 938 days before Qwen3-Coder-Next, so benchmark comparisons should account for the intervening progress.
Context windows are 100k (Claude 2) vs 256k (Qwen3-Coder-Next). Claude 2 is proprietary, while Qwen3-Coder-Next is open weight.
